Industry leaders share their advice with Young Property Professionals

Our Young Property Professionals (YPP) committees across the country recently joined forces to hold a webinar series with some of Australia’s leading property professionals. Over six episodes, attendees gained perspective and insight from these leaders on current markets, their career history and their best advice for graduates in a difficult employment market.
